The
Gulf of the Farallones Marine Sanctuary is home to some of
the world's largest great white sharks. The area off the coast
of San Francisco is the winter water playground of adult great
white sharks measuring 15 to 20 feet long. (4.5 meters to 6.1
meters). The sharks come to the Farallones to dine on the local
population of Northern Elephant Seals. You'll find yourself
rooting for the seals as they compete in a race for their lives
against some of the planet's most incredible marine predators.
